Flowtite fibreglass pipes and fittings are used in many applications. They can be found in the transmission of drinking water, in fire fighting, sea and desalinated water , in power plants, in chemical and industrial wastes as well as in sewage applications and irrigation. The use of Flowtite pipe systems is virtually unlimited. You will find our products in siphon lines just as much as in sea-water outfalls, bridge dewatering, desalination projects and as protection lines for cables. Flow Coefficients
The Colebrook - White coefficient was tested at 0,029mm, This corresponds to a Hazen-Williams flow coefficient of approximately C = 150,

Water Hammer
Water hammer - or pressure surge - is the sudden rise or fall in pressure, caused by an abrupt change in fluid velocity within the the pipe system, The most important factors,

India Operations
Amiantit Fiberglass Industries India Private Limited (AFIIPL) is a JV company between Amiantit and Mr. Shivanand Salgaocar, Goa. AFIIPL has a-state-of-the-art plant for manufacturing Continuous Filament Wound Glass Reinforced Polyester (GRP) Pipes for water distribution, sewerage and storage tanks. The plant is located in North Goa covering an area of 60 acres of land with an investment of over USD 10 million. Since commissioning in July 2003, AFIIPL has produced more than 250 kms of Pipe/Shells from diameter 300mm to 3200mm. The plant is equipped with latest equipment in terms of machine and has one of the most sophisticated laboratories for testing the mechanical and technical properties of both raw material and finished goods.
